River Bluff running back Riley Myers with the carry against Chapin this past week in The Swamp. Myers rushed for 134 yards and a touchdown in the 33-7 victory over the Eagles. The win evened River Bluff’s mark to 1-1 overall, 1-1 in Region 5-5A in just its 2nd game of the regular season. The Gators next travel to White Knoll this Friday, while Chapin plays host to Lexington at Cecil Woofbright Field. PHOTO| WWW.GOFLASHWIN.COM
